您的位置:首页 >动态 > 互联数码科技知识 >

音:Android音频系统之音频框架_安卓10音频架构 🎶📱

导读 随着科技的发展,智能手机的功能越来越强大,而音频体验作为其中不可或缺的一部分,也得到了飞速发展。今天,让我们一起探索Android 10的...

随着科技的发展,智能手机的功能越来越强大,而音频体验作为其中不可或缺的一部分,也得到了飞速发展。今天,让我们一起探索Android 10的音频架构,揭开它神秘的面纱。🔍

首先,我们要了解的是Android音频系统的整体框架。它主要包括应用层、框架层和内核层三层结构。每一层都有其特定的功能,共同协作以提供高质量的音频服务。👩‍💻👨‍💻

在应用层,开发者可以利用各种API来实现音频播放、录制等功能。例如,通过MediaPlayer类,我们可以轻松地播放音乐文件。🎵

接着是框架层,这是Android音频系统的核心部分。在这里,所有的音频请求都会被处理,并由底层硬件执行。这个过程中,AudioFlinger扮演了重要角色,它负责管理音频流,确保音频数据能够正确地从源传输到目标。🔗

最后是内核层,这里包含了与音频相关的驱动程序,直接与硬件交互。这层的设计直接影响到音频信号的质量和稳定性。🔧

通过以上介绍,我们可以看到,Android 10的音频架构是一个复杂但高效的工作体系,为用户提供了一个稳定且高质量的音频体验。🌟

希望这篇简短的介绍能帮助大家更好地理解Android音频系统的内部工作原理。如果你对音频技术感兴趣,不妨深入研究一下,也许会有意想不到的发现!💡

版权声明:转载此文是出于传递更多信息之目的。若有来源标注错误或侵犯了您的合法权益,请作者持权属证明与本网联系,我们将及时更正、删除,谢谢您的支持与理解。
关键词: